# Cold Storage Archival — notes for the weekly eng sync (Team Permafrost)
# This config governs the nightly sweep that moves buckets untouched for 180+
# days from the Tarnwell hot tier into Glacierpoint cold storage. Please review
# ARCHIVE_BATCH_SIZE carefully before changing it; batches over 500 objects
# have caused manifest timeouts twice this quarter. Restores must go through
# the ops queue, never directly. The sweep job authenticates to the
# Glacierpoint API with the key declared on the next line.

secret setting of kagug-tajep: COURIER_KEY8=e81a8675

## Safe Lock Replacement — Records Room B

The old dial lock on the Records Room B safe finally gave up, so Marlow Securit is sending a replacement unit by courier this week. Heads up: the lock ships pre-coded, so treat the parcel like the documents it'll protect. Don't leave it at reception. The courier's been given the hand-over instruction below.

handover note for fahof-yagug: the gordor lamath courier leaves the zorath oliael gileth ledger at gate 6225 under passcode 056860

- [ ] **Step 7: Breaker override escrow.** After sealing the signing keys for the Tallgrove upstream API circuit breaker, confirm the support team can force the breaker open during a full outage. The override bundle lives in the sealed escrow drawer and is useless without its unlock phrase. Two ceremony witnesses must initial this step before proceeding. The escrow bundle is decrypted with the recovery passphrase that follows.

vault phrase of kahip-kahop = holath-quenmir